That depends on condition, presentation, mods and service history. I just sold my 2001 4Mo with 105k miles for £2200, but it was in particularly good condition and I'd spent a lot on it which was plain to see with new suspension, and brakes all round, refurbished wheels etc. The trouble with the 4Mo is it's a wonderful car, but a little too under the radar for many, they don't have a lot of resale value just now.
My advice is give it a through clean and polish your car up inside and out and stick it on gumtree to see what the response is like. I sold mine in 24 hours of putting it up!

I think theres a huge variation on the prices of these, some are dirt cheap but im sure that these cars will be older mistreated examples with poor bodywork and worn interiors little to no service history. Ive seen what appeared to be enthusiast owned cars that have been looked after properly since new going for around 3K yours seems to be roughly in the middle so id say around 2K. if yours has the BDE engine you can still get parts from VW which would be good news for a potential buyer the older engine ( not sure on the code) now has obsolete parts.
